4.11 Module-Level Constants
Source: grammar.ebnf § constant_decl, spec/12-constants.md
Module-level constants declared with let $NAME = value.
let $PI = 3.14159
let $MAX_SIZE: int = 1000
pub let $VERSION = "1.0.0"
Status: Parser complete, evaluator incomplete.

4.12 Extension Methods
PROPOSAL:
proposals/approved/extension-methods-proposal.md
Extension methods add methods to existing types without modifying their definition.

Method Resolution
-
Implement: Resolution order — proposals/approved/extension-methods-proposal.md § Resolution Order
- Inherent > Trait > Extension
- Rust Tests:
ori_types/src/check/— resolution order tests - Ori Tests:
tests/spec/extensions/resolution_order.ori
-
Implement: Conflict detection — proposals/approved/extension-methods-proposal.md § Conflict Resolution
- Error on ambiguous extension methods
- Qualified syntax for disambiguation:
module.Type.method(v) - Rust Tests:
ori_types/src/check/— conflict detection tests - Ori Tests:
tests/spec/extensions/conflict.ori
Orphan Rules
- Implement: Same-package rule — proposals/approved/extension-methods-proposal.md § Orphan Rules
- Extension must be in same package as type OR trait bound
- Error for foreign type without local trait bound
- Rust Tests:
ori_types/src/check/— orphan rule tests - Ori Tests:
tests/spec/extensions/orphan.ori
